Technical field
The present invention relates to a kind of slow-release fertilizer, and in particular to a kind of low cost, the environmentally friendly coating with water retaining function The preparation method of slow-release fertilizer.
Technical background
It with granular chemical fertilizer is heart core that coating slowly/controlled releasing fertilizer is, surface coats one layer of inorganic matter or organic of slightly water-soluble High molecular polymer, the material can change the release characteristics of chemical fertilizer nutrient, extension or control fertilizer nutrient release, make its nutrient The new-type fertilizer that release is mutually coordinated with the regulation of fertilizer requirement of crop.The development of this kind of fertilizer is raising utilization rate of fertilizer, mitigates environment The modern agriculture that pollution, development save labor proposes new thinking.Therefore, fertilizer science, agrology, environmental science, chemistry etc. The researcher of subject sets foot in the field one after another, and achieves large quantities of valuable achievements in research.At present, oneself applies and just grinds The slow/controlled release material studied carefully can be divided into inorganic (ore deposit) thing powder, organic high molecular polymer, environmentally friendly material (organic-inorganic Compound) three major types.
Ni Bo stands in its Master dissertation《The preparation of environmental friend type multifunction sustained-controll-release fertiliser and performance study》 In, a kind of the fertilizer of retaining water and releasing nutrients slowly is prepared for using sodium alginate and polyacrylic acid, but it is easy to fall off also to there is water-loss reducer, and coating is prevented It is aqueous to have much room for improvement, and slow release it is not good enough the problems such as.
The content of the invention
Thinking based on more than, difficult for drop-off the invention provides a kind of water-loss reducer, coating good waterproof performance, slow release effect is excellent Good environmentally friendly film-coated and slow release fertilizer, and preparation method thereof.
The technical problems to be solved by the invention are realized using following technical scheme:
A kind of low cost, the environmentally friendly film-coated and slow release fertilizer with water retaining function, it is characterised in that be by following weight portion Raw material is made:
Guar gum 20-30, acrylic acid 10-20, sodium alginate soln 20-30, borax soln 20-30, ammonium persulfate 1-2, N, N ,-methylene-bisacrylamide 3-6, attapulgite 2-3, polyvinyl alcohol 15-25, starch 3-5, urea 25-35, potassium hydrogen phosphate 8- 15, distilled water 50-100;
The sodium alginate soln mass fraction is 5%-30%, and calcium chloride solution mass fraction is 7%-15%, borax soln quality Fraction is 4%-10%'s.
The preparation method of a kind of described low cost, the environmentally friendly film-coated and slow release fertilizer with water retaining function, its feature It is to be made up of following steps:
A. by acrylic acid, ammonium persulfate and N, N ,-methylene-bisacrylamide adds distilled water to be made mixed solution, is added dropwise to In sodium alginate soln, lasting stirring;Logical nitrogen is after 15 minutes, the water-bath 2-5h under the conditions of 60-80 DEG C;Reaction terminates Afterwards, water-loss reducer is obtained after filtering, dry, crushing, sieving;
B. by polyvinyl alcohol addition distilled water, stirring is heated to 80-95 DEG C, continues stirring until it and is completely dissolved, and stops adding Heat, adds gelatinized starch, stirring 20-40min to obtain polyvinyl alcohol-starch crosslinked fluid;Then to 3-5 parts of urine of addition in crosslinked fluid Element, step a gained water-loss reducers, sealing are vibrated in water-bath at 40-60 DEG C, are cooled to room temperature, obtain urea-modified and contain water-loss reducer Crosslinked fluid;
C. remaining urea, attapulgite, potassium hydrogen phosphate are added in guar gum powder, are placed in the disk of rotation, make Guar Rubber powder end is wrapped in fertilizer outer layer, and sprays into borax soln guar gum is crosslinked, and the guar gum after crosslinking is used as fertilizer Internal layer coating;
D. step c gained fertilizer kernels are put into the rotary drum of rotation, step b gained crosslinked fluids are sprayed into spray gun for paint, in 60- Heating makes solvent volatilize at 80 DEG C, and product is obtained final product after drying.
The preparation method of a kind of described low cost, the environmentally friendly film-coated and slow release fertilizer with water retaining function, its feature It is that the preparation method of the gelatinized starch is that starch is added in distilled water, under the conditions of 60-80 DEG C, stirring in water bath is obtained Arrive.
The beneficial effects of the invention are as follows:The macromolecular skeleton of sodium alginate is grafted to by polypropylene by graft polymerization reaction On acid molecule chain, a kind of agricultural water-loss reducer material of polysaccharide-based is prepared into, solves polyacrylic water-loss reducer degradability difference Problem;With urea come modified polyvinylalcohol-starch crosslinked fluid, two amino contained using urea, the hydroxyl contained with crosslinked fluid Base chemically reacts, and generates cyclic organic compounds, can reach and shelter light base, improves the purpose of membrane material water resistance;Will Water-loss reducer is added in crosslinked fluid, is then sprayed on again on fertilizer kernel, overcomes and water-loss reducer directly is sticked into fertilizer kernel When the caducous defect of water-loss reducer that exists, make the Water-saving effect of fertilizer notable;Crosslinked fluid can also reach enhancing fertilizer simultaneously The purpose of water resistance, while easily biological-degradable, environment-friendly;With guar gum as the inner investment of fertilizer, the cost of fertilizer is reduced, And with preferable slow release and water-retaining property.

Properties of product test data of the invention:When rate of fertilizer is 1%, soil maximum specific retention >=47.5%;Nutrition Release percentage≤99%, 81.3%, 91.1% in elemental nitrogen, phosphorus and potassium 30 days in soil.
